Richard James NIGHTINGALE

Regimental number1374
Place of birthPlymouth, England
ReligionBaptist
OccupationRailway employee
Marital statusMarried
Age at embarkation24.8
Height5' 7.75"
Weight134 lbs
Next of kinMrs Sophie Jane Nightingale, 'Glecoe', Lennark Street, Enfield, New South Wales
Previous military serviceNil
Enlistment date30 January 1915
Unit name20th Battalion, D Company
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/37/5
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T A35 Berrima on 26 June 1915
Rank from Nominal RollLance Corporal
Unit from Nominal Roll20th Battalion
FateReturned to Australia 15 April 1918
Discharge date18 July 1918
Other details

War service: Egypt, Gallipoli, Western Front

Commenced return to Australia on board HT 'Marathon', 15 April 1918; discharged (medically unfit: neurasthenia), Sydney, 18 July 1918.

Medals: 1914-15 Star, British War Medal, Victory Medal
